VMware Cloud Foundation 9.1
An alarm is triggered during the transitional phase of the VCF 9.1 upgrade before all hosts are operating on the target version.

VMware by Broadcom Engineering is aware of and is investigating the exact cause of this issue.
If the alarms were present in the environment prior to initiating the VCF 9.1 upgrade -- or after the VCF 9.1 upgrade is fully complete, they are likely real issues. In that scenario, please consult "High pNic error rate detected" alarm triggered for vSAN ESXi host for further troubleshooting.
